Description

3-Formyl-5-Methylphenylboronic Acid is a versatile and high-value boronic acid derivative, serving as a critical building block in modern synthetic chemistry. Its primary value lies in its dual functionality, combining a reactive formyl group with a boronic acid moiety, enabling its use in advanced cross-coupling reactions and as a precursor for complex molecular architectures. This compound is essential for researchers and manufacturers in the pharmaceutical, agrochemical, and material science industries who require precise and reliable intermediates for developing active ingredients and functional materials.

Application

  • Pharmaceutical Intermediate: A key precursor in Suzuki-Miyaura cross-coupling reactions for synthesizing novel drug candidates, especially in oncology and CNS therapeutic areas.
  • Agrochemical Synthesis: Used to construct complex molecules for advanced pesticides and herbicides, leveraging its boronic acid functionality for selective bond formation.
  • Material Science & OLED Development: Acts as a building block for creating organic light-emitting diode (OLED) materials and other advanced organic electronic components.
  • Ligand & Catalyst Preparation: Employed in the synthesis of specialized ligands for catalysis and metal-organic frameworks (MOFs).
  • Chemical Research & Development: Serves as a versatile reagent in academic and industrial R&D for exploring new synthetic pathways and creating compound libraries.
  • Fine Chemical Production: Integral to the multi-step synthesis of complex fine chemicals and specialty dyes.

Basic Information

Product Name 3-Formyl-5-Methylphenylboronic Acid
CAS No. 870777-33-6
Molecular Formula C8H9BO3
Molecular Weight 163.97 g/mol
Synonyms 5-Methyl-3-formylphenylboronic Acid; (3-Formyl-5-methylphenyl)boronic Acid; 3-Formyl-5-methylbenzeneboronic Acid; 3-Carbaldehyde-5-methylphenylboronic Acid; Boronic acid, B-(3-formyl-5-methylphenyl)-; 870777-33-6; 5-Methyl-3-carboxaldehydephenylboronic Acid

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). This compound is hygroscopic (moisture-sensitive) and light-sensitive; therefore, containers must be kept tightly sealed and under an inert atmosphere (e.g., nitrogen or argon) for long-term storage to prevent degradation. Keep away from incompatible materials.
